Surge in Relocation-Based Job Openings Across Ukraine
Ukraine's labor market is showing significant activity in 2025, with a notable increase in job postings that include relocation assistance. Over 4,500 such positions are currently available, particularly within the country's industrial regions, signaling a dynamic shift in employment opportunities.
In-Demand Occupations and Regional Hotspots
The roles most sought after by Ukrainian employers currently include:
- Drivers and installation technicians
- Loaders and maintenance fitters
- Seamstresses and cooks
- Security guards
The Dnipropetrovsk region leads in vacancy numbers, with 706 openings listed. Kyiv and the surrounding Kyiv region also account for a substantial portion of the market, offering more than 1,300 jobs that include accommodation. A further 475 vacancies are open in the Lviv region, underscoring the nationwide demand for labor. This trend reflects the broader economic recovery efforts following the full-scale invasion, where rebuilding and industrial output are priorities.
By the end of 2025, approximately 800 of these positions remained unfilled, indicating the labor market is still adjusting to new economic realities. The rising demand for jobs with relocation packages serves as a key indicator for job seekers considering opportunities within Ukraine.
